Pickup and Schedule

The tour commences with a hotel pickup at 8:00 AM, ensuring a seamless start to the day’s adventure. After the initial pickup, the group will travel to the Chiangdao Cave, where they’ll embark on a 2.5-hour trekking expedition with a knowledgeable local guide. Next, the journey continues to the Doiluang Crayfish Farm and Cafe, allowing for a relaxing 1.5-hour break to enjoy refreshments and take in the picturesque surroundings. The final stop is the captivating Bua Thong Sticky Waterfalls, where participants can spend around 100 minutes exploring the unique limestone formations and cooling off in the refreshing waters. The tour concludes with a hotel drop-off at 6:00 PM.

Bua Thong Sticky Waterfalls

Chiangdao Cave Trekking, Cafe & Sticky Waterfall(Private) - Bua Thong Sticky Waterfalls

Wrapping up the day’s adventures, visitors ascend to the captivating Bua Thong Sticky Waterfalls.

Climbing the unique limestone rocks, they’re greeted by a mesmerizing sight – cascading waters that defy gravity, clinging to the surfaces. Immersing themselves in the refreshing pools, they revel in the serene ambiance, surrounded by lush greenery.

The waterfall’s distinctive name, "Sticky", derives from its remarkable texture, allowing visitors to effortlessly scale the wet, yet sturdy, rock formations.

Preparation and Recommendations

To ensure a comfortable and enjoyable experience, adventurers are encouraged to wear suitable attire. Comfortable, closed-toe shoes are a must, as the terrain can be uneven and slippery.

A change of clothes is recommended, especially for the visit to the Sticky Waterfall, where participants can expect to get wet. Water shoes or sandals are also suggested to navigate the limestone rocks.

Bringing a light jacket or sweater is advisable, as the cave can be cool. Lastly, don’t forget to pack a reusable water bottle to stay hydrated during the day’s activities.

What Is the Best Time of Year to Visit the Attractions?

The best time to visit the attractions is during the dry season from November to April when the weather is cooler and drier, making it ideal for exploring caves, waterfalls, and enjoying outdoor activities.
